Description Harry ten Berge 2005-09-02 06:41:13 UTC
The syslinux package as used in SUSE Pro and OpenSUSE is of version 2.11.

However, syslinux 3.10 is already available, and in the meantime a lot of
bugfixes has gone in. These fixes are/could be important for some machine BIOSses.

Comment 3 Steffen Winterfeldt 2005-09-05 09:15:20 UTC
syslinux 3.x has had serious problems with disk accesses due to do the core 
rewrite HPA did in that area. 
 
I'll update for the next release.
